如何利用AI语音SDK开发语音内容审核系统?

随着互联网的快速发展,网络信息传播速度越来越快,内容审核成为了维护网络秩序、保护未成年人健康成长的重要手段。近年来,AI技术的飞速发展,为内容审核提供了新的解决方案。本文将介绍如何利用AI语音SDK开发语音内容审核系统,并通过一个真实案例来展示其应用效果。

一、AI语音SDK简介

AI语音SDK(语音识别与合成开发包)是一种基于人工智能技术的语音处理工具,能够实现语音识别、语音合成、语音识别与合成结合等功能。通过调用SDK接口,开发者可以轻松地将语音识别、语音合成等功能集成到自己的应用中。

二、语音内容审核系统概述

语音内容审核系统是一种基于AI语音SDK的智能审核工具,通过对语音内容进行实时识别、分析、判断,实现对不良语音内容的自动过滤。该系统主要由以下几个模块组成:

  1. 语音采集模块:负责采集待审核的语音数据。

  2. 语音识别模块:将采集到的语音数据转换为文本,为后续分析提供基础。

  3. 文本分析模块:对识别出的文本进行语义分析,识别不良词汇、敏感词等。

  4. 审核决策模块:根据文本分析结果,判断语音内容是否合规。

  5. 审核反馈模块:对审核结果进行记录、统计,为后续优化提供数据支持。

三、利用AI语音SDK开发语音内容审核系统

  1. 选择合适的AI语音SDK

目前市场上主流的AI语音SDK有百度语音、科大讯飞、腾讯云等。在选择SDK时,需要考虑以下因素:

(1)识别准确率:准确率越高,审核效果越好。

(2)识别速度:速度快,用户体验更佳。

(3)功能丰富度:满足不同场景下的需求。

(4)价格:根据自身预算选择合适的SDK。


  1. 集成语音识别功能

将选定的AI语音SDK集成到项目中,调用语音识别接口,将采集到的语音数据转换为文本。


  1. 文本分析模块开发

根据实际需求,开发文本分析模块。可以使用以下方法:

(1)使用现有的敏感词库:从网络上下载或购买敏感词库,用于识别不良词汇。

(2)自定义敏感词库:根据自身业务需求,添加或删除敏感词。

(3)使用自然语言处理技术:利用NLP技术对文本进行语义分析,识别不良内容。


  1. 审核决策模块开发

根据文本分析结果,判断语音内容是否合规。可以采用以下策略:

(1)阈值判断:设置敏感词或敏感句的阈值,超过阈值则判定为不良内容。

(2)人工审核:对于难以判断的内容,可以设置人工审核环节。


  1. 审核反馈模块开发

对审核结果进行记录、统计,为后续优化提供数据支持。可以采用以下方法:

(1)日志记录:记录审核过程中的关键信息,如识别出的敏感词、审核结果等。

(2)数据统计:对审核结果进行统计分析,为优化算法提供依据。

四、案例分析

某直播平台为了提高用户体验,降低不良内容传播风险,决定引入语音内容审核系统。经过调研,该平台选择了百度语音SDK作为语音识别工具。

  1. 集成语音识别功能

将百度语音SDK集成到直播平台中,实现语音采集、识别等功能。


  1. 文本分析模块开发

根据平台需求,自定义敏感词库,并利用百度语音SDK提供的NLP技术进行语义分析。


  1. 审核决策模块开发

设置敏感词阈值,当识别出的敏感词数量超过阈值时,判定为不良内容。


  1. 审核反馈模块开发

记录审核过程中的关键信息,并对审核结果进行统计分析。

经过一段时间的运行,该语音内容审核系统取得了良好的效果。不良语音内容的传播得到了有效遏制,用户体验得到了显著提升。

总结

利用AI语音SDK开发语音内容审核系统,可以有效提高内容审核效率,降低不良内容传播风险。在实际应用中,需要根据自身需求选择合适的AI语音SDK,并不断完善文本分析、审核决策等模块,以实现更好的审核效果。

猜你喜欢:AI语音聊天